And there is a a school of thought here. It's the eighty twenty rule. 20% of the of what you're doing is actually going to make a difference. Whereas the 80%, which is the comfort zone, is probably what's gonna keep you stuck. So we have to go to that 20%. What is your 20%? For a long time, for me, I needed to grow my audience. And so for a long time, it was I got stuck because I wanted to launch his podcast and I couldn't do it. It took me two years to launch his podcast because the thought of being visible and speaking and doing it every week and having to commit scared the heebie jeebies out of me.

Karen Davies [00:10:58]:
It absolutely terrified me. And then having to promote my podcast and then position myself as a podcaster and actually take ownership of my content. Oh my god. That was scary. Took me two years. Now I look back and I think, oh my god. I wasted two years. Because podcasting's the best thing I've done.

Karen Davies [00:11:18]:
I absolutely love it. Then it came to webinars. Those webinars, honestly, for years, I would book in a webinar to teach something and I'd cancel it because I was fearful of the unknown. I didn't know how it was gonna go. And I thought I'd fail. So I cancelled them. I'd book them in. I'd do a bit of promotion.

Karen Davies [00:11:39]:
And then as the day got nearer, I'd cancel. Because I was fearful. I was scared of failing. I didn't want people not to turn up, and I and I didn't wanna confront the fact that that could be an option, so I canceled them. It was out of fear. So what are you doing, and what could you do differently? Webinars for me now, most months I run them and they are by far one of the best tools that I could use to grow my audience. But again, I missed out on so much time because I was trapped in fear. The moment I stepped out of fear, things started to happen.
